dRock's Panther Platform Horsepower and Torque Rating Page
All of this info is directly from brochures and owner's manuals from Ford.
All 1992+ panthers have a 4.6l engine. Town Car first recieved the 4.6l for 1991 model year.
The 2003-2004 Marauder uses a 4.6l DOHC (4v), all others are the 4.6l SOHC (2v)
For panther platform cars:
| Year | Panther Model | nPI/PI (4.6l SOHC) | Exhaust | TQ & HP |
| -'91 | CV/GMQ/TC *Exc. '91 TC | 5.0l | single | 270lb-ft 150hp |
| -'91 | CV/GMQ/TC *Exc. '91 TC | 5.0l | dual | 280lb-ft 160hp |
| '92-'95 | -ALL- | nPI | single | 260lb-ft 190hp |
| '92-'95 | -ALL- | nPI | dual | 270lb-ft 210hp |
| '96-'97 | -ALL- | nPI | single | 265ft-lb 190hp |
| '96-'97 | -ALL- | nPI | dual | 275ft-lb 210hp |
| '98-'00 | -ALL- | nPI | single | 275ft-lb 200hp |
| '98-'00 | -ALL- | nPI | dual | 285ft-lb 215hp |
| '98-'99 | **Town Car (only) | nPI | single | 280lb-ft 205hp |
| '98-'99 | **Town Car (only) | nPI | dual | 290 lb-ft 220hp |
| '01-'02 | -ALL- | PI | single | 265ft-lb 220hp |
| '01-'02 | -ALL- | PI | dual | 275ft-lb 235hp |
| '03+ | -ALL- | PI | single | 275ft-lb 224hp |
| '03+ | -ALL- | PI | dual | 287ft-lb 239hp |
| '04+ | CVPI | PI | dual | 297lb-ft 250hp |
| '03-'04 | Marauder | 4.6 DOHC/4V | dual | 318lb-ft 302hp |
Notes:
- 1992+ Crown Victoria / Grand Marquis and 1991+ Town Car use the 4.6l SOHC engine, sucessor to the 5.0l (and 5.8l certain models) engine
- '92 ('91 TC) -'95 models use an all-aluminum Intake manifold
- '96+ Use a composite (Dupont Zytel) intake manifold. Keeping the nPI port design the '96- manifold increased engine torque output and reduced manifold heat-soak.
- '98+ Use an electric primary fan (years prior were mechanical), which creates less drag on FEAD
- '98+ models have a Coil-On-Plug ignition system, though the electric fan upgrade and slight engine tuning enhancement are more responsible for the slight power increase.
- '01+ Panthers use a PI (Performance Improved) engine - featuring better flowing heads and intake, revised camshafts and increased piston dish. The PI engine moved the power band higher and peak torque was reduced. PI improvements first appeared on '99 Mustang and Truck modular engines.
- '03+ Panthers make use of an engine Knock sensor (98-99 T.C. as well), which allows for more agressive igniton timing with less chance of pre-detonation/spark-knock.
- '04+ CVPI (only) use a revised airbox w/ 80mm MAF, based off of 03-04 Marauder airbox, improving inlet airflow. This brought the power output of the 4.6l 2v to it's highest yet in our platform, 250hp (just 10hp shy of '99-'04 Mustang GTs)
**Excluding vehicles produced for sale in CA,NY, MA, CN
